President Trump signed an executive order Thursday adjusting reciprocal tariffs on numerous countries. New duties range from 10% to 41%, with an additional 40% tariff for goods transshipped to evade duties. Countries not on the list face a 10% increase. The order modifies April's directive, effective seven days after issuance. Canadian exports will see a tariff hike to 35%, excluding USMCA-covered goods.
